Specification for railway turnouts for private users. Medium grade turnouts over which British Railways locomotives do not operate, for axle loads not exceeding 25 tons Turnouts using bull head rail

Turnouts from straight track, 4 ft 8½ in gauge, nomenclature, materials, design, production, inspection, identification marking, layout, leading and detail dimensions. Appendix gives recommended minimum requirements for partly worn rails.
